Infinix ZERO Series Mini Tri-Fold Smartphone Concept for Young Consumers

Designed and developed for young consumers, here’s Infinix ZERO Series Mini Tri-Fold Smartphone. It’s a tech brand known for its trendy and stylish signature design to attract younger customers and this time, it reveals a foldable phone concept. ZERO Series seamlessly transforms from a smartphone to a compact camera or to a hands-free fitness. It aims to become an entertainment companion for its user, unlocking new possibilities for mobility, creativity and functionality.

The design features a triple-folding mechanism with dual hinges that fold and unfold vertically onto itself. It offers a new perspective on how our smart device an also integrate into our modern lifestyles.

Infinix ZERO Series Mini Tri-Fold Smartphone is not your another foldable phone. Infinix claims that this smart product is a bold reimagination of how technology can enhance our everyday life while evolving seamlessly between different forms. You can mount it on your gym equipment for tracking or clip it onto your backpack for action shots. It’s a pocket-friendly smartphone thanks to its foldable design, it promises unmatched versatility.

Through the use of outward-folding design, this phone unlocks many possibilities. The dual-screen allows real-time multilingual conversations can be done effortlessly, both users can view translated content side by side. Built for single-handed use, Zero Series Mini Tri-Fold is lightweight and intuitive, blurring the line between a smartphone and all-in-one gadget companion.
